The cheapest way to get from Mokra Gora to Dubrovnik is to bus which costs €35 - €45 and takes 7h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Mokra Gora to Dubrovnik is to drive which takes 4h 7m and costs €35 - €55.
No, there is no direct bus from Mokra Gora to Dubrovnik. However, there are services departing from Mokra Gora and arriving at Dubrovnik, Autobusni kolodvor via Goražde and Neum, Pekarna - Hotel Jadran.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 21m.
The distance between Mokra Gora and Dubrovnik is 341 km. The road distance is 255.2 km.
The best way to get from Mokra Gora to Dubrovnik without a car is to bus which takes 7h 21m and costs €35 - €45.
It takes approximately 7h 21m to get from Mokra Gora to Dubrovnik, including transfers.
